Question : The Constitution of India was adopted by the Constituent Assembly in the year ______.

Option 1: 1947

Option 2: 1949

Option 3: 1950

Option 4: 1948

Team Careers360 3rd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: 1949


Solution : The correct answer is 1949.

Question : Which of the following ports in India has been renamed as Deendayal Port?

Option 1: Mormugao

Option 2: Tuticorin

Option 3: Cochin

Option 4: Kandla

Team Careers360 13th Jan, 2024

Correct Answer: Kandla


Solution : The correct option is Kandla.

The Kandla Port in India is the port that was renamed as Deendayal Port. On September 25, 2017, it was renamed Deendayal Port in honour of Pandit Deendayal Upadhyaya, a well-known economist, political philosopher and Bharatiya Jana Sangh leader.
